The strongest acid that can exist in water would be the hydronium ion, H3O+. HCl and HNO3 are solid acids because they are superior proton donors than H3O+ and primarily donate all their protons to H2O, leveling their acid power to that of H3O+. In the different solvent HCl and HNO3 might not behave as sturdy acids.
